The AP2125AN-2.8TRG1 is a voltage regulator belonging to the category of integrated circuits. It is commonly used in electronic devices to regulate voltage and ensure stable power supply to various components. The AP2125AN-2.8TRG1 has a standard SOT-23-5 package with the following pin configuration: 1. VIN (Input Voltage) 2. GND (Ground) 3. NC (No Connection) 4. VOUT (Output Voltage) 5. EN (Enable)
The AP2125AN-2.8TRG1 operates by comparing the output voltage to a reference voltage and adjusting the pass element to maintain a stable output. When the input voltage fluctuates, the regulator adjusts the pass element to ensure a consistent output voltage.
The AP2125AN-2.8TRG1 is widely used in portable electronic devices such as smartphones, tablets, and portable media players. Its compact size and efficient voltage regulation make it ideal for battery-powered applications where space and power efficiency are critical.
